[ https://issues.apache.org/jira/browse/JCLOUDS-849?page=com.atlassian.jira.plugin.system.issuetabpanels:comment-tabpanel&focusedCommentId=14379668#comment-14379668 ]
fabio martelli commented on JCLOUDS-849: ---------------------------------------- Hi, probably I get the solution. I changed AzureManagementApiMetadata.defaultProperties() methos as following. Test in progres. public static Properties defaultProperties() { final Properties properties = BaseHttpApiMetadata.defaultProperties(); // Sometimes SSH Authentication failure happens in Azure. // It seems that the authorized key is injected after ssh has been started. properties.setProperty("jclouds.ssh.max-retries", "7"); properties.setProperty("jclouds.ssh.retry-auth", "true"); return properties; } > Add the live test that extends the BaseComputeServiceLiveTest > ------------------------------------------------------------- > > Key: JCLOUDS-849 > URL: https://issues.apache.org/jira/browse/JCLOUDS-849 > Project: jclouds > Issue Type: Sub-task > Components: jclouds-compute, jclouds-labs > Reporter: Ignasi Barrera > Assignee: fabio martelli > Labels: azure > Fix For: 2.0.0 > > > The BaseComputeServiceLiveTest provides the contract of the ComputeService > abstraction. All compute providers must have a test that extends the base one > with all live tests passing. > An example implemention can be the DigitalOcean one: > https://github.com/jclouds/jclouds-labs/blob/master/digitalocean/src/main/java/org/jclouds/digitalocean/compute/strategy/DigitalOceanComputeServiceAdapter.java -- This message was sent by Atlassian JIRA (v6.3.4#6332)